Output 324912b87e3183577f244443bfa400f45418ba817a44beab30cbdd4cd5f0ba40:0

value
6963012806437
script pubkey
OP_0 OP_PUSHBYTES_20 80c11bd2ee5a9e7c7b16cf6e4d1755201d0679e2
address
tb1qsrq3h5hwt208c7ckeahy6964yqwsv70z3qd265
transaction
324912b87e3183577f244443bfa400f45418ba817a44beab30cbdd4cd5f0ba40
confirmations
184984
spent
true